[CA][walmart.ca] The CC Expiration Date is not autofilled

Preconditions

  • set pref browser.search.region to CA in about:config
  • use CA VPN
  • have at least one CC saved in about:preferences#privacy

Steps to reproduce

  1. Go to https://www.walmart.ca/en
  2. Add an item to cart and proceed to checkout
  3. Autofill in the details for Credit Card
  4. Observe the Expiration Date field

Expected result

  • The Expiration Date field is properly autofilled with the saved values.

Actual result

  • The Expiration Date field is not autofilled.

I am still able to reproduce the issue using Firefox Nightly 132.0a1, as described in Comment 0.
Expiration date filed is not autofilled when autofilling is triggered from the credit card number field.
However, I have noticed that the expiration date field is autofilled when autofilling is triggered from the First name / Surname fields.
Setting extensions.formautofill.heuristics.autofillSameOriginWithTop to True does not solve the issue.
